Banks to Remain Closed for Public Dealing on January 1

News Desk 

Karachi: The State Bank of Pakistan (SBP) on Tuesday announced a nationwide bank holiday on January 1, 2026, during which all banks and financial institutions will remain closed for public dealing.

In a statement, the central bank said that the bank holiday will apply to commercial banks, development finance institutions (DFIs), and microfinance banks (MFBs) across the country.

However, the SBP clarified that bank employees will attend their offices as usual on the day, as the closure is intended solely for public transactions.

The annual bank holiday is observed to allow financial institutions to complete year-end accounting and operational processes and to ensure a smooth transition into the new financial year.
